Owing to the clarion call by the Executive Secretary Ms Flavia to the global UNVs sometimes in 2009 to volunteer and contribute to the Global Climate Change which International Community also during the Copenhagen summit deliberated in search of solutions.
Inspired by this call and especially considering the background of the country (Sudan) which I was serving as a volunteer, I initiated an idea whereby some kilos of a plant seeds grown in my house yard in Nigeria were taken to Sudan.
I consulted with some forest and environmentalist as to the viability and sustainability of the tree planting project initiative. A trial session was carried out and it was successful (the seed germinated).
A stakeholders meeting comprising refugee community leaders, local community, host government, school teachers in the refugee camps, water and sanitation NGOs in the camps etc were held and strategies were mapped out that gave rise to a successful tree planting event in the open desert of the eastern Sudan refugee camps: http://www.unv.org/en/news-resources/news/doc/planting-trees-for-shade.html; http://www.ng.undp.org/unv/titus_success_story.shtml
